Output 8066812c01685f60a2bded7219c5d035b15147c4e0d72317100687832aa3c080:0

value
60133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 728a37f409139ba2a869a488d703259ef15da6bc OP_EQUAL
address
3C8eY1MJ4BBSqvBPY121p47Ww7NNU6PhMs
transaction
8066812c01685f60a2bded7219c5d035b15147c4e0d72317100687832aa3c080
spent
true